How they compare

Colombia currently reports 3.62 %LSU against 3.49 %LSU in Cook Islands, a difference of 0.13 %LSU.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 63 shared years of data; in 1961 it was Cook Islands ahead.

Colombia ranks 28th and Cook Islands ranks 30th of 164 countries.

Across the 7 decades both report, Colombia averaged higher in 4 and Cook Islands in 3.

The Livestock Patterns domain of FAOSTAT contains data on livestock numbers, shares of major livestock species and densities of livestock units in the agricultural land area. Values are calculated using Livestock Units (LSU), which facilitate aggregating information for different livestock types. Data are available by country, with global coverage, for the period 1961 to the most recent year available with annual updates. This methodology applies the LSU coefficients reported in the "Guidelines for the preparation of livestock sector reviews" (FAO, 2011). From this publication, LSU coefficients are computed by livestock type and by country. The reference unit used for the calculation of livestock units (=1 LSU) is the grazing equivalent of one adult dairy cow producing 3000 kg of milk annually, fed without additional concentrated foodstuffs. FAOSTAT agri-environmental indicators on livestock patterns closely follow the structure of the indicators in EUROSTAT.
